WORLD CUP 2026 – SEMI FINALS

SEMI FINALS PREVIEW WITH UK KICK-OFF TIMES

1 Tuesday 14th July – New York – 8pm

France v Spain

France go into the semi final in confident mood after a straightforward 2-0 win over Morocco despite Mbappe’s penalty miss. Spain just did enough to see off Belgium and still look like a team trying to find cohesion with their star players not fully fit.

France seem to have strength in depth and gears still to go through if needed and should make it through to the final.

2 Wednesday 15th July – Miami – 8pm

England v Argentina

England just did enough to see off Norway but struggled for long spells as Norway passed the ball around. Bellingham was the difference with two goals particularly his first goal which showed great touch and composure. Kane has been influential and good at winning free kicks in dangerous areas and penalties.

Argentina look a class act with their will to win keeping them going through many tough times in this World Cup. They also have good strength in the forward areas, with Messi , Alvarez and Martinez all scoring.

Argentina with their know how and attacking threat, may be too much for England especially if they allow the opposition to dominate possession again as the did against Norway.
